Features

特性

High Performance

高性能

Hardware-accelerated pixel format conversion with up to 10x speedup using AVX2, Apple Accelerate, and NEON.

Native support for Windows dual backends (DirectShow by default, Media Foundation also supported), macOS/iOS (AVFoundation), and Linux (V4L2).

Helical gear generators are specialized software tools, physical machine attachments, or mathematical algorithms used to design and manufacture helical gears. Unlike standard spur gears, helical gears feature teeth cut at an angle to the gear axis. This helical angle creates a smoother, quieter, and more efficient power transmission, making them essential in automotive transmissions, industrial machinery, and high-speed reduction units.

A manual CAD approach—extruding, patterning, and twisting a tooth profile—is not only tedious but also lacks true parametric intelligence. A dedicated helical gear generator automates this process, allowing the designer to input basic parameters and receive a watertight solid model ready for simulation, analysis, or manufacturing (hobbing, 3D printing, or milling).

For internal helical gears (ring gears), Wire EDM is superior. The generator must calculate the tapered 3D path of the wire as it cuts through the workpiece, twisting as it moves up the Z-axis.
